1562.0. "problem registering TS" by CLARID::HOFSTEE (Take a RISC, buy a VAX) Mon Sep 30 1991 11:14

I am having a problem using the TSAM . I just installed it , and the 
IVP was successfull. It is version T1.0.0.

When I try to register a terminal server (in this case a DS500), I go through
the normal screens to specify the name, address etc. When I then click on the 
iconic map, to place the icon, I get the message

MCC internal error : MCC-E-DNF Directory not found.

The same happens through FCL. I have been using this system for the
past couple of weeks to register NODE4's and other stuff, all without 
problems. Any idea what directory (if any) is missing and why?

1562.2Correct directory is .MCC_TERMINAL_SERVER_BACKTRANSLATIONCUJO::HILLDan Hill-Net.Mgt.-Customer ResidentTue Oct 01 1991 12:1910
    Timo,
    
    After double-checking, the DNS directory is
    
    			.MCC_TERMINAL_SERVER_BACKTRANSLATION
                                                       ^  
    Use DNSCP  (MCR DNS$CONTROL) and CREATE DIRECTORY  |
